What is Septic Inspection and Diagnosis?

Septic Inspection and Diagnosis is a full check of your septic system. We look at your tanks, pipes, and drain fields to find problems early. This helps prevent backups, leaks, and costly repairs.

 

Small problems in a septic system can grow quickly. Inspections catch leaks, clogs, and other issues before they cause damage to your home or yard.

 

Most homes need a septic inspection every 2–3 years. Older systems or high-usage homes may need inspections more often.

 

Our team checks your tank, pipes, and drain field. We use specialized tools to identify leaks, blockages, or failing components. Afterward, we provide a clear report with next steps.
